Company's Culture
The shared values, norms, practices, and beliefs that characterize an organization and influence how employees behave and interact with each other.
Founder
An individual who establishes an organization, company, or initiative.
Socialization Process
refers to the procedure by which an individual learns and acquires the norms, values, behavior, and social skills appropriate to their social position.
Financial Success
The achievement of financial goals and the accumulation of wealth or resources to a level deemed successful by individual or societal standards.
